## Artifact Signing: Currency Rounding Fixes

The Lendrova conversion module previously truncated sub-cent amounts during multi-hop conversions, producing cumulative drift of up to 0.4% on batch settlements. Build 3.9.2 switches to banker's rounding with a single terminal round step. All signed artifacts from this build must be verified before deploy. Verification requires the current signing key, shown below.

rollout seal: bky4_DFM9

## Changelog — Ticktrace 1.9

### Renamed: DRIFT_API_TOKEN
During the cron drift investigation we found plugins confusing this variable with the metrics token, so it has been renamed to indicate it authorizes drift-report uploads specifically. Plugin authors must read the new name from 1.9 onward; the old name is ignored without warning. Sample env files in the SDK are updated. In your deployment env file, the drift-report upload secret is set on the next line.

env line for fawef-taguf: VAULT_KEY13=a9695905a9a90

# Encoding sniffer config — Tallowmere Uploads service.
# We guess charset from the first 64KB; if confidence drops below 0.8 we fall
# back to UTF-8 and flag the file for review. Release managers: bump
# SNIFF_SAMPLE_KB cautiously, it affects upload latency. The sniffer calls the
# hosted detection model, which requires auth. The line below sets that key.

sealed setting: RELAY_SECRET3=1be

Memo to Branch Managers — Retail Pilot. Quick update: our pilot with the Kellersby chain kicks off next month across six of their stores, featuring the Lumabrace display units. Please don't promise rollout dates to customers yet — we're still testing logistics with the Fernvale depot. Questions go to Odette. The wider plan behind this pilot is outlined below.

confidential, bahap-bajog: Zorethix Works is in early talks to buy Kelethox Foods for about $30.7 million. The Ralvan launch date is September 19, and nothing goes to the press before then.

Subject: Template rendering perf — Quenby 4.2

Team,

Rendering latency in the Quenby template engine dropped 31% after we cached compiled partials. No change to escaping or sandbox behavior; security posture is unchanged. Full benchmark output is attached to the release ticket. The build token for the measured artifact follows.

pipeline stamp: htk9_ce63042d9